Bosch SHX78CC5UC: running cost
ENERGY STAR certifies the Bosch SHX78CC5UC at 240 kWh/yr, about average for its category to run for its category.

Where this ranks
That's 3.4% above the dishwasher category average of 232 kWh/yr, and ranks 426 of 737 certified dishwashers for annual running cost, 1 being cheapest. Every one of the 737 currently-certified dishwashers feeds that average, putting this model about $2/year over it. See how it's calculated on the how it is calculated page.

Bosch SHX78CC5UC over 9 years
9 years is NAHB's typical service life for this category; at $45/year, the Bosch SHX78CC5UC adds up to about $406 in electricity over that span.
